Ved AI (Gen AI-powered Chatbot)

Overview

Ved is the AI-powered assistant for vuSmartMaps™, designed to simplify incident investigation and alert analysis through natural language interactions. Instead of manually navigating multiple dashboards and operational views, users can ask questions in plain language and receive relevant, explainable insights in real time.

Ved helps users investigate incidents, analyze alerts, explore operational trends, and perform guided root cause analysis through an intuitive chat-based interface. Responses are enriched with structured summaries, investigation-focused insights, reasoning traces, and visualizations to support faster troubleshooting and informed operational decision-making.

With support for multi-turn interactions, real-time streaming responses, and explainable investigation workflows, Ved delivers an interactive and efficient operational analysis experience that helps improve productivity and streamline incident investigations across enterprise environments.

Example Scenario

A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) team receives multiple critical alerts indicating increased response time across a payment application. Instead of manually navigating dashboards and correlating alerts, the engineer launches Ved and asks, "What is the probable root cause of the latest incident?" Ved analyzes the available operational data, retrieves relevant incident details, provides an AI-generated summary, identifies the most likely root cause, and displays supporting reasoning and related sources. The engineer continues the investigation with follow-up questions, reviews the recommended actions, and quickly resolves the issue without switching between multiple monitoring screens.

Page / Screen Overview

The Ved interface provides an AI-powered conversational workspace that enables users to investigate incidents, analyze alerts, and retrieve operational insights using natural language. The interface combines conversational interactions with explainable AI to simplify operational investigations and accelerate troubleshooting.

The Ved interface consists of the following major sections:

  • Conversation History – Displays recent conversations and allows users to search, revisit, or continue previous investigations.
  • Search Conversations – Helps locate previous conversations using keywords or phrases.
  • Chat Window – Allows users to enter natural language queries and view AI-generated responses.
  • Response Panel – Displays investigation summaries, operational insights, charts, recommendations, and follow-up responses.
  • Sources & Reasoning – Provides supporting evidence and explains how Ved generated the response.
  • Response Actions – Allows users to copy responses, provide feedback, download conversations, or delete conversation history.
  • User Guide Access – Provides quick access to the Ved documentation directly from the interface.

Step-by-step instructions

Follow these steps to begin using Ved:

  1. Verify that Ved is enabled for your user account and environment.
  2. Open the vuSmartMaps interface.
  3. Click the Ved icon available in the bottom-right corner of the screen.
  4. Select New Chat to start a new investigation session.
  5. Enter your query using natural language.
  6. Review the generated response, insights, and recommendations.
  7. Ask follow-up questions to continue the investigation within the same conversation.
  8. Review Sources and Reasoning sections for additional context and explainability.
  9. Copy, download, or share investigation findings if required.
  10. Continue exploring incidents, alerts, and operational trends using conversational interactions.

Intelligent Data Access with MCP

Ved uses a secure and structured integration approach through MCP (Model Context Protocol) to retrieve operational insights from configured vuSmartMaps data sources. MCP enables Ved to interact with platform data in a controlled manner, helping deliver accurate, reliable, and explainable responses.

By using MCP-based integrations, Ved can intelligently access relevant operational information during investigations without requiring users to manually navigate multiple dashboards or monitoring tools.

This enables Ved to:

  • Retrieve relevant incident and alert information during investigations
  • Access operational insights in real time
  • Correlate related investigation signals across available data sources
  • Improve response relevance by using investigation-specific context
  • Enhance data retrieval accuracy through controlled access to platform data
  • Provide structured and explainable responses

MCP-driven integrations help improve investigation efficiency by enabling Ved to access the most relevant operational information available, resulting in more accurate insights and streamlined troubleshooting workflows.

note

Available integrations and accessible data sources may vary depending on platform configuration and enabled capabilities.

Context-Aware Ved Integration

Ved can be integrated directly within dashboards, incident views, and operational workflows to provide contextual investigation assistance.

As shown in the interface, specific records or operational entities may include a dedicated Ved icon. Clicking the Ved icon automatically opens the Ved assistant with prefilled contextual information and a predefined investigation query related to the selected item.

This enables users to:

  • Start investigations directly from operational dashboards
  • Analyze incidents without manually entering queries
  • Automatically pass incident-specific context to Ved
  • Accelerate troubleshooting and root cause analysis
  • Seamlessly continue investigations conversationally

For example, selecting the Ved icon for a specific incident automatically opens Ved with a contextual query such as:

“Can you describe the incident <Incident ID> in detail?”

Ved then uses the selected operational context to generate investigation-focused insights and analysis relevant to the chosen incident or alert.

This contextual integration capability can be leveraged across supported dashboards, operational views, and workflows where contextual AI-assisted investigations are required.

Troubleshooting

  1. Issue: Ved icon is not visible.
    • Possible Cause: Ved is not enabled for the user account or environment.
    • Solution: Contact your administrator or support team to enable Ved for your environment.
  2. Issue: Unable to start a new conversation.
    • Possible Cause: Browser session issues or insufficient user permissions.
    • Solution: Refresh the page and verify that your account has the required permissions to access Ved.
  3. Issue: No response is generated after submitting a query.
    • Possible Cause: Query processing is still in progress, or the required operational data is unavailable.
    • Solution: Wait for processing to complete and verify platform connectivity before submitting the query again.
  4. Issue: Response does not contain the expected information.
    • Possible Cause: Required operational data is unavailable, or the query is outside the currently supported scope.
    • Solution: Rephrase the query using more specific details and verify that the required operational data is available.
  5. Issue: Sources or Reasoning sections are unavailable.
    • Possible Cause: Explainability information is not available for the current response.
    • Solution: Submit a more specific investigation query and retry the request.
  6. Issue: Search Conversations does not return the expected results.
    • Possible Cause: The search keywords do not match any stored conversations.
    • Solution: Use broader keywords or alternative search terms to locate the required conversation.
  7. Issue: Download Conversation option is unavailable.
    • Possible Cause: The conversation has not been generated yet, or your account does not have the required permissions.
    • Solution: Ensure the conversation contains generated responses and verify your access permissions before retrying.
  8. Issue: Unable to delete a conversation.
    • Possible Cause: Insufficient permissions or a temporary interface issue.
    • Solution: Refresh the interface and verify that your account has permission to delete conversations.
  9. Issue: Context-aware investigation does not open automatically.
    • Possible Cause: Contextual integration has not been configured for the selected dashboard or workflow.
    • Solution: Launch Ved manually and provide the relevant incident or alert details to begin the investigation.
  10. Issue: Response quality appears inaccurate.
    • Possible Cause: Limited context or incomplete operational data is available for analysis.
    • Solution: Provide additional context through follow-up questions and review the supporting evidence before making operational decisions.
